Accurate Colors Thanks to White Balance Calibration

Most color detectors get fooled by lighting: a white shirt looks yellow under a warm lamp and bluish in the shade. WhatColor.ai solves this with white balance calibration — point the camera at a plain white sheet of paper, press “Set WB”, and the tool compensates for the tint of your light source. The result is the true color of the object, not the color of your lighting.

Who Is This Color Identifier For?

People with color blindness. If you have deuteranopia, protanopia or another color vision deficiency, the detector answers everyday questions instantly: is this shirt green or brown? Which wire is red? Is this banana ripe? The color name is shown in simple words, so you can shop, dress and work with confidence.

Designers and developers. Grab the exact HEX or RGB of any real-world color — a fabric sample, a printed logo, a paint swatch — and use it directly in your project.

Everyone else. Matching paint at the hardware store, describing a product color for an online listing, settling a “what color is this dress” debate — point, tap, done.

Frequently Asked Questions

How accurate is the color detection?

Accuracy depends mostly on lighting. Use the white balance calibration with a white sheet of paper, and the detected color will closely match the real color of the object.

Does it work in poor lighting?

It works best in even, reasonably bright light. In dim or strongly tinted lighting, white balance calibration corrects most of the color cast. In near darkness no camera can detect colors reliably.

What is white balance?

White balance compensates for the color tint of the light source.
